Weidmüller 1005460150 SAIL-ZW-M12BG-3-1.5U M12 Sensor-Actuator Adaptor Cable
The Weidmüller 1005460150 SAIL-ZW-M12BG-3-1.5U is a 3-pole M12 sensor-actuator adaptor cable with a 1.5 m length and a twin-cabling structure. It uses a straight M12 A-coded male connector on one side and two straight M12 A-coded female connectors on the other side. This configuration makes the cable relevant in industrial automation layouts where one connection point needs to interface with two downstream M12 connections in a compact but practical format.

Unlike generic cabling, this product is a ready-to-connect industrial adaptor cable built to a defined connector standard. The interface is based on IEC 61076-2-101, and the M12 connectors are listed as A-coded. Both male and female connector ends are straight, which simplifies routing where angled connector geometry is unnecessary.
Technical Details
The SAIL-ZW-M12BG-3-1.5U is specified as a 3-pole M12 / M12 connecting line with twin cabling, no shielding, and no LED. The product page lists a halogen-free PUR sheath and a net weight of approximately 91.52 g. The connectors are described within the same design family as M12 A-coded versions with IP68 protection. That aligns the cable with industrial use cases where moisture resistance and robust connector sealing are important.
Representative series-level technical data for this cable design includes a 4 A rated current, 250 V rated voltage, gold-plated contacts, 0.34 mm² conductor cross-section, a 3.8 mm ± 0.15 mm outer diameter, drag-chain suitability, 0.8 to 1.2 Nm M12 tightening torque, and resistance to oil, hydrolysis, and microbes. These details help explain why such cables are often selected for moving equipment, industrial handling systems, and automation environments exposed to vibration or routine washdown-related stress.

Weidmüller 1005460150 FAQ
What is the Weidmüller 1005460150 cable type?
It is a ready-to-connect M12 sensor-actuator adaptor cable with one straight male M12 connector and two straight female M12 connectors in a twin-cabling design.
How long is SAIL-ZW-M12BG-3-1.5U?
The cable length is 1.5 m.
How many poles does this cable have?
The product is a 3-pole, A-coded M12 cable.
Is the cable shielded or fitted with LEDs?
No. The official product description states that it is unshielded and has no LED.
What outer sheath material is used?
The cable uses a halogen-free PUR sheath in black.
